..


Link-uri sponsorizate

Un sistem de autentificare cu jQuery Ajax si PHP

Articol scris de Max Bossi
Pagina 1 din 2

În acest articollo vom vedea cum pentru a crea un sistem complet de autentificare a utilizatorilor pe bază de Ajax.

Pentru a atinge scopul nostru, vom utiliza biblioteca jQuery (care face viaţa mai uşoară pentru noi, pentru a dezvolta client-side), ceea ce limbaj PHP pentru server-side operaţiuni şi MySQL pentru acces stirage ghidul de date.

Baza de date

Aşa cum am menţionat, vom folosi MySQL pentru a stoca datele de utilizatori "autentificare. În acest scop, prin urmare, avem nevoie de un tabel de "utilizatori", organizat, după cum urmează:
  • id - int (20), cheie primară, auto increment
  • numele de utilizator - varchar (100)
  • parola - varchar (100)
Deschis, prin urmare, phpMyAdmin (sau orice alt software pentru gestionarea de MySQL) şi de a crea tabel cu câmpurile specificate.

Scopul a câmpului cred ca este absolut clar: "id" este identificatorul unic, în "numele de utilizator" vom înregistra numele utilizatorului şi, în sfârşit, în "parola" vom salva parolele trece prin dopoaverle md5 () funcţie.

În sensul prezentului articol nu este semnificativă pentru a crea pagina de înregistrare de utilizator. Să avoi şef de echipaj, prin urmare, pentru a popula baza de date cu unele date de test.

HTML forma

Pentru a crea un formular de autentificare avem nevoie, desigur, un formular HTML. Să urmaţi codul de formularul nostru:






 <form method="post" id="modulo_login" />



  



 <table border="0">



  



 <tr> <td> Nume de utilizator: </ td> <input name = <td> "username" type = "text" id = "username" maxlength = "10" style = "width: 250px" /> </ td> </ tr>



  



 <tr> <td> Parola: </ td> <input name = <td> "parola" type = "parola" id = "parola" maxlength = "10" style = "width: 250px" /> </ td> </ tr>



  



 <tr> <td> <input type="submit" id="submit" value="Entra" /> </ td> <div id = <td> "messaggio"> </ div> </ td> </ tr>



  



 </ Table>







 </ Form>



Un varf de cutit de CSS

În scopul de a arăta frumos în activitatea noastră avem nevoie de cateva linii de CSS.
Desigur, toate aspectele legate de foaia de stil pot fi adaptate pentru a se potrivi nevoilor dvs.:






 div







 de intrare {



  



 font-family: Arial, Verdana;



  



 font-size: 12px;

  





 }







 . Incorect,







 . Eroare {



  



 padding: 3px;



  



 text-align: center;







 }







 . Incorect,







 . Eroare {



  



 lăţime: auto;



  



 font-Greutate: bold;



  



 frontieră: 1px solid # 349534;



  



 background: # C9FFCA;



  



 color: # 008000;







 }







 . Eroare {



  



 frontieră: 1px solid # CC0000;



  



 background: # F7CBCA;



  



 color: # CC0000;







 }



În aceeaşi categorie ...
E-Learning
ASP Zero (Ebook) ASP Zero (Ebook)
Microsoft Learning ASP şi VBScript de la zero. La doar 29 €.
Javascript (Curs) Javascript (Curs)
Ghid complet pentru client-side scripting. De la 39 €.
PHP (Curs) PHP (Curs)
Ciclu complet pentru crearea de site-uri Web dinamice. De la 49 €.
Link-uri sponsorizate